Electronic Visit Verification Soft Launch Ends for PHPs

Effective Nov. 01, 2021, all encounters subject to EVV will require an EVV visit history.

The Electronic Visit Verification (EVV) soft launch for providers authorized to render personal care services subject to EVV through the prepaid health plan (PHP) payer type will end on Oct. 31, 2021.

All encounters submitted on and after Nov. 1, 2021, will require the EVV evidence to assist with adjudicating the claim. Beginning Dec. 1, 2021, ALL encounters for personal care claims must contain EVV data, regardless of the date of service.

Providers who are not integrated with their EVV vendor must make every attempt to begin integration before Oct. 31, 2021. Providers who have not initiated integration with their EVV vendor before the expiration of the soft launch will not be eligible to seek hardship advances when encounters are denied due to missing EVV data.
